The Complex Link Between Fermentation and Histamine
Kefir, a fermented milk product beloved for its probiotic content, is made by adding kefir grains—a symbiotic culture of bacteria and yeast—to milk. This fermentation process is what gives kefir its health benefits, but it is also the source of its histamine content. Histamine is a biogenic amine, a chemical compound produced when certain bacteria convert the amino acid histidine into histamine through an enzymatic reaction. Because kefir is a fermented food, it inherently contains biogenic amines, including histamine.
Unlike an allergic reaction, which is triggered by an overactive immune system, histamine intolerance occurs when there is a buildup of histamine in the body because the enzyme responsible for breaking it down, Diamine Oxidase (DAO), is either deficient or blocked. For a person with histamine intolerance, consuming foods with high levels of histamine, or those that trigger histamine release, can lead to a variety of symptoms, from headaches and hives to digestive issues and fatigue.
Factors Influencing Kefir's Histamine Content
The amount of histamine in kefir is not static; it is influenced by several key factors during its production:
- Fermentation time: The longer the fermentation process, the more time the bacteria have to produce histamine. Therefore, a shorter fermentation time generally results in lower histamine levels.
- Temperature: Higher fermentation temperatures can accelerate bacterial growth and increase histamine production. Fermenting at a lower, controlled temperature can help mitigate this effect.
- Microbial strains: The specific strains of bacteria and yeast in the kefir grains play a significant role. Some strains produce histamine, while others have been found to degrade it. The microbial composition can vary widely depending on the grain source.
- Milk source: The type of milk used can affect histamine levels. Dairy milk, particularly from pasture-fed cows, is rich in amino acids, which serve as precursors for biogenic amines. Non-dairy kefirs (made with water or coconut milk) have a different nutritional profile, which can result in different histamine levels.
- Grain health: Fresh, well-maintained kefir grains are more likely to produce a consistent product. Older or improperly stored grains may contain different microbial populations that could affect histamine content.
Navigating Kefir with Histamine Intolerance
Individuals with histamine intolerance must navigate their diet carefully, and kefir is a prime example of a food that can be either problematic or tolerable depending on the individual and the preparation. Some research even suggests that certain compounds in kefir, like kefiran, may have anti-inflammatory properties that could potentially benefit those with histamine issues. However, this does not negate the histamine content. A key concept for those with histamine intolerance is the "histamine bucket"—the total amount of histamine their body can handle from all sources (dietary, environmental, etc.) before symptoms appear. For some, a small amount of kefir may be fine, while for others, any amount could be a trigger.
Comparing High- and Low-Histamine Foods
| High-Histamine Foods to Limit | Low-Histamine Alternatives to Enjoy |
|---|---|
| Fermented dairy: Aged cheeses, sour cream | Fresh dairy: Milk, mascarpone, fresh mozzarella |
| Fermented vegetables: Sauerkraut, kimchi, pickles | Fresh vegetables: Most fresh veggies, including carrots and cabbage |
| Processed/cured meats: Salami, ham, sausages | Freshly cooked meats: Poultry, lamb, beef |
| Alcohol: Wine, beer, champagne | Beverages: Water, herbal teas, most fresh juices |
| Certain fruits: Citrus fruits, strawberries, pineapple | Other fruits: Apples, pears, mangoes |
| Legumes: Lentils, beans, soy products | Grains: Quinoa, rice, oats |
Strategies for Consuming Kefir with Histamine Sensitivity
If you are considering adding kefir to your diet but have histamine concerns, these strategies can help minimize potential triggers:
- Start with small amounts: Begin with just a teaspoon and observe your body's reaction. Gradually increase the dosage if you don't experience adverse effects.
- Shorten fermentation time: To reduce the time bacteria have to produce histamine, ferment your kefir for a shorter period (e.g., 12-18 hours instead of 24-48).
- Ferment at a lower temperature: Keep the fermentation environment cooler than room temperature, as this will slow down the bacteria's activity and, consequently, the production of histamine.
- Use fresh ingredients: Always use fresh milk and healthy, active kefir grains. Histamine levels can increase as food ages or spoils.
- Consider low-histamine alternatives: If dairy kefir is problematic, try making water kefir with a short fermentation time, as it generally has lower histamine levels. Some probiotic supplements containing specific histamine-degrading strains might also be an option.
- Seek professional guidance: Working with a dietitian or healthcare professional knowledgeable about histamine intolerance is crucial for creating a balanced and safe dietary plan.
The Role of Probiotic Strains in Histamine Regulation
As research into the microbiome expands, scientists are uncovering how specific probiotic strains affect histamine levels. Some strains, particularly those from the Bifidobacterium genus (B. longum, B. infantis) and certain Lactobacillus plantarum strains, are considered beneficial for managing histamine levels. They either do not produce histamine or may actively help degrade it. Conversely, some common probiotic strains like Lactobacillus casei and Lactobacillus bulgaricus are known histamine producers and should be approached with caution by sensitive individuals. This highlights the importance of not all probiotics being created equal when it comes to histamine management.

Conclusion
In summary, is kefir high in histamine? It has the potential to be, but the actual level is highly dependent on how it is made. As a fermented food, it contains varying amounts of histamine due to microbial activity. For individuals with histamine intolerance, this means kefir is not a universally safe food and requires a cautious, personalized approach. By controlling fermentation conditions, starting with small quantities, and paying close attention to your body's reaction, you may be able to incorporate kefir into your diet. However, for those highly sensitive to histamine, it may be best to avoid it altogether or explore alternative probiotic sources that are known to be low-histamine.
